Comprehensive Guide to Shirasaya Katana

A shirasaya Japanese sword is a traditional form of Japanese blade storage and presentation that differs significantly from the ornamental decorative scabbard used in formal settings. The term "shirasaya" literally translates to "white scabbard," referring to the plain wooden blade housing case that protects the blade without elaborate decoration or metalwork. This plain scabbard design serves a critical functional purpose: it preserves the blade in its most natural state while preventing rust, corrosion, and environmental damage. At Musashi Swords, we understand that a shirasaya blade represents the purest form of Japanese sword craftsmanship, where the focus remains entirely on the metal's quality, curve, and balance rather than the aesthetic presentation of the scabbard itself.

The design and construction of a katana shirasaya involve precise woodworking and understanding of how moisture, temperature, and time affect steel. Unlike the elaborate lacquered housing seen in display models, a traditional shirasaya housing is crafted from lightweight wood that allows the blade to fit snugly while enabling easy removal for maintenance and inspection. The interior of the storage case is typically left smooth and unfinished to reduce friction against the blade's surface. This careful attention to detail ensures that your handcrafted shirasaya sword remains in optimal condition for years or even decades. The fitting process requires skill and experience—the traditional storage case must be tight enough to protect the metal from environmental exposure yet loose enough to prevent warping or binding when removing or inserting the blade.
